What the lenders care about on heavy iron

Deal structures that fit this equipment

Longer terms. Because dozers and loaders hold value, terms stretch to 72 and 84 months on newer units, which keeps the payment in line with what the machine bills.

Seasonal and skip payments. Sitework slows in winter in half the country. Some programs allow reduced or skipped payments in the off months on established contractors.

Refinance and cash-out. Own a loader free and clear? A sale-leaseback or equipment-backed loan turns it into working capital for the next job without selling it.

Fleet adds. Buying three machines from one dealer? One application, one set of documents, one payment.

Questions we get

Can I finance a dozer with under two years in business?

Yes. Start-up programs typically want 10 to 20 percent down, a personal guarantee, and proof of experience or a contract for the work. The machine itself carries a lot of the credit decision because it holds value.

Do you finance used wheel loaders from auction?

Yes. Get pre-approved before the sale so the lender can pay inside the auction window. Ritchie Bros, IronPlanet, and regional auctions are all routine.

What is the oldest dozer you can finance?

Most programs go 10 to 15 years. Older units with rebuilt drivetrains and a full inspection can still work through story-credit lenders, usually with a shorter term.

Can I roll in the lowboy?

Yes. Trailer, attachments, delivery, and sales tax can go on the same contract, subject to the total advance the program allows.
